  • Publication number: 20180369538
    Abstract: Provided is a catheter to be inserted into an object. The catheter includes a main body having a tubular shape and an expansion layer formed on an outer circumferential surface of the main body, and the expansion layer contains an expandable material which is expanded by contact with a liquid.

  • Patent number: 10007131
    Abstract: A method for repairing a display device including a defective pixel area where a failure has occurred includes irradiating a first laser beam to a first interface provided between a first layer and a second layer that contact each other corresponding to the defective pixel area to form a protrusion-depression surface in one or more surfaces of the first layer and the second layer that form the first interface; and irradiating a second laser beam to the protrusion-depression surfaces provided in one or more surfaces of the first and second layers to burn the protrusion-depression surface.

  • Patent number: 8604406
    Abstract: The low power image sensor includes: an image sensing unit which senses light from an object, converts the light into an electric signal, and outputs the electric signal; a comparing unit which receives an electric signal from the image sensor, compares a voltage level of the electric signal with a reference voltage, and outputs an image signal as a 1 bit signal per pixel; and an effective image adjuster which compares bit value distribution of an image signal output from the comparing unit with a preset effective range, and adjusts the reference voltage to output an effective image. Further, an optical pointing device includes: an image sensor which senses light from an object and outputs an image signal; and a motion computing unit which receives the image signal and compares before and after images to calculate a motion vector.
